Accendra Health (ACH) is One of The 15 Best NYSE Penny Stocks According to Hedge Funds

Accendra Health Inc. (NYSE:ACH) said on June 23 it completed exchange offers for its 4.5% senior notes due 2029 and 6.625% senior notes due 2030. The notes were exchanged for new 9% senior secured first-lien notes due 2032 and 9.75% senior secured second-lien notes due 2033. Accendra expects to issue about $539.25 million first-lien notes and about $698.1 million second-lien notes, while S&P Global Ratings affirmed a 'B' issuer rating and moved outlook to stable.

Accendra Health (ACH) Q2 2026 Earnings Call Transcript

Accendra Health (ACH) reported Q2 2026 revenue of $613.2M, down from $681.9M YoY, and adjusted EBITDA of $60.1M, down from $96.6M. The company revised full-year revenue guidance to $2.45B-$2.55B and adjusted EBITDA to $300M-$320M, citing slower growth and collection rate issues. Total debt decreased by $385M to $1.72B. CEO Edward Pesicka announced his retirement by year-end.

Accendra Health Reports Lower Q2 Revenue, Sets 2026 Guidance; Adopts Tax Asset Plan; Stock Down

Accendra Health (ACH) reported Q2 2026 revenue of $613.2 million, down from $681.9 million a year earlier, with GAAP net loss of $89.1 million ($1.16/share). Non-GAAP adjusted net loss was $14.3 million. Adjusted EBITDA fell to $60.1 million and free cash flow was -$25.1 million. The company guided FY2026 revenue $2.45-$2.55 billion and adjusted EBITDA $300-$320 million, and adopted a tax asset preservation plan.

Alibaba’s $10.2B Hong Kong Share Sale Excluded US Holders From Discount: Insiders Bought Anyway

Alibaba raised $10.2B in Hong Kong's largest-ever primary follow-on share offering, pricing 710M shares at an 8.4% discount. US investors were excluded due to regulatory restrictions. Shares fell up to 10% post-offering, with insiders like Chairman Joe Tsai and CEO Eddie Wu buying shares, signaling confidence. Proceeds will fund AI, cloud, and chip investments. U.S. preps $1.1B loan for Ivanhoe’s Santa Cruz copper project

Ivanhoe Electric (NYSE-A, TSX: IE) may receive a $1.1B loan from the U.S. Export-Import Bank for its Santa Cruz copper project in Arizona. The loan is a third larger than previously proposed. The project could become a major U.S. copper mine, with an estimated $1.24B initial cost and potential annual production of 72,000 tonnes. Shares gained 1% to $16.03 on Monday.
